Most WP-0012 tasks are gated on external owners shipping paths that do not exist yet. They should not sit as inert `todo` tasks, nor be fabricated as active entries. They should live as **suggestions that accrue demand pressure** every time they are needed-but-unmet, so in-demand work is promoted to real tasks first. ## Problem The hub today cannot represent "a need that has been raised but not yet vetted or scheduled, whose urgency grows with repeated demand." Concretely: - `NextStep` suggestions are **derived on the fly and never persisted** (`api/schemas/state.py`), so they cannot accumulate anything. - There is **no relevance/demand counter** on any entity. - There is **no suggestion → vetted requirement → task** promotion pipeline. `CapabilityRequest` is the closest analog but models cross-domain brokering, and a repeat need spawns a *new* request rather than bumping demand on an existing one. - The **WSJF triage is advisory** (activity-core `daily-statehub-wsjf-triage`, CUST-WP-0044) and consumes current summary/workplan/progress state — **no persisted demand signal feeds it**, and the hub holds no Cost-of-Delay / Job-Size data model. ## Approach (decided) - **New `Suggestion` entity** (not an extension of `CapabilityRequest`/`TechnicalDebt`). Stages: `suggestion` → `requirement` (vetted + structured) → `promoted` (became a Task); plus terminal `declined`. Append-only `SuggestionNote` trail (mirrors `TDNote`) records vetting. `promoted_task_id` links the resulting `Task`. - **Relevance is a persisted demand counter.** It increments whenever the suggestion is *needed but not yet done* (defined in T3). `relevance` + `last_requested_at` + a `relevance_events` count drive ranking. - **WSJF is computed in the hub as a read-model projection** and exposed via a ranked endpoint; the existing activity-core daily triage **consumes** it. `wsjf = cost_of_delay / job_size`, where `cost_of_delay = base_value + (relevance_weight × relevance)` so repeated demand raises priority. Job size is an operator-set estimate (default medium). - Promotion keeps the active task backlog clean: gated needs (the WP-0012 case) live as relevance-accruing suggestions, **not** as inert `todo` tasks or fabricated active catalog entries. > **Read-model boundary (ADR-001 / hub design):** suggestion writes are a new > sanctioned write surface alongside `resolve_decision` and `get_next_steps`. > `bump_relevance`, `promote_suggestion_to_task`, and vetting transitions are the > only writes; ranking/WSJF are pure projections. T6 records the ADR amendment. ## Open questions (resolve during T1/T4, do not block proposal) - Exact WSJF cost-of-delay decomposition (single `base_value` vs SAFe triple of business-value / time-criticality / risk-reduction).
